The German Panther tank was introduced in 1943 and is believed to be one of the best German tanks in World War II.
The Sherman wasn’t the best tank, but thanks to efficient American production methods it would be the most prolific. The United States built a staggering 49,234 Sherman tanks between 1942 and 1945.
